Former PGA EuroPro Tour player Robert Rock picked up the biggest paycheque of his career in the Irish Open after losing in a play-off to amateur victor Shane Lowry at Baltray.
Rock, who played on the EuroPro Tour in 2002, 2003 and 2005, lost out after a bogey on the third play-off hole, but pocketed the €500,000 first prize cheque due to Lowry’s amateur status. It was his second runners-up cheque in as many weeks after he finished in a three-way tie for second at the Italian Open in Torino last week.
On the Challenge Tour, John Parry and Lloyd Kennedy (pictured) finished well at the ALLIANZ Open Cotes d’Armor Bretagne in Brittany. Parry finished three shots behind the winner in third place while Kennedy finished in sixth – both players won on last year’s EuroPro Tour, with Kennedy finishing third in the Order of Merit and Parry in tenth.
